Brufen Mechanism of Action

Brufen Mechanism of Action
To understand the sleepiness effects of Brufen, it is essential to examine its mechanism of action. Ibuprofen works by inhibiting the production of prostaglandins, which are hormone-like substances that cause pain, inflammation, and fever. By blocking the enzyme cyclooxygenase (COX), Brufen reduces the synthesis of prostaglandins, thereby alleviating pain and inflammation. However, this mechanism can also influence the body's sleep-wake cycle, as prostaglandins play a role in regulating sleep and wakefulness.

Prostaglandins and Sleep Regulation

The relationship between prostaglandins and sleep regulation is complex and not fully understood. However, research suggests that prostaglandins, particularly prostaglandin D2 (PGD2), can promote sleepiness and regulate the sleep-wake cycle. PGD2 is produced in the brain and plays a role in inducing sleep, while its inhibition can lead to increased alertness. By reducing prostaglandin production, Brufen may disrupt the normal sleep-wake cycle, leading to drowsiness or sleepiness in some individuals.
